Hi Koda,

Attacks against the largest massed defenders:
We abandoned reporting on this as we deemed it entirely pointless (albeit potentially funny).  Does anyone care if 1 commander and 3 spears attacked a mass of 1m+ units?

Highest attacker kill ratios:
Given the antipathy to the idea of sharing specific players' combat API keys and the desire to repress information about the exact casualties that players individually experienced, we felt that this information wouldn't be happily accepted by the advocates for the limited-data key.  Plus because we didn't provide it the last time we ran a king-of-the-hill tournament, we didn't feel we should provide it this time.

Casualties by Race:
Yes, this is good aggregate stats, and will happily provide.  Give me a couple of days.

Casualties by region (Atk Casualties and Def Casualties):
As directly above; will provide.

XP stats:
I can certainly re-run the stats provided (and the ones I will provide shortly) with their XP equivalents
